Case study: Arabella Ramsay and NOJA Power
International Business Cadet Program 2009

Powering new networks for export success

NOJA Power has experienced first-hand the success that can be achieved from developing new contacts in market through the International Business Cadet program.

Managing Director of NOJA Power, Neil O'Sullivan said that thanks to their sponsorship of Arabella Ramsay as the company's cadet they were able to significantly expand their US client base.

"When Arabella joined us as our cadet in 2009, we set her the task of expanding our existing channels in the US through identifying and appointing new sales representatives," Mr O'Sullivan said.

"The global marketplace is a key focus for our marketing, with our high voltage switchgear products currently being supplied to more than 70 countries.

"Maintaining NOJA's expansion in new markets is therefore a high priority for us, so Trade and Investment Queensland's cadetship was an ideal opportunity to identify new opportunities.

"The outcomes speak for themselves - Arabella identified representatives in more than 50 per cent of the states in which we were not represented, which in turn generated significant sales results.

"Our experience with the program has generated ongoing benefits for NOJA Power, with most of those new representatives still representing us today and making sales."

Arabella has also enjoyed the benefits of the cadetship in her own career.

"Through my work with NOJA Power and the cadet program I gained an excellent insight into the export and investment process for Queensland businesses, and the global economic environment," she said.

"The program allowed me to put into practice my Bachelor degrees in Commerce and Economics from UQ in a very hands-on job, and learn from a highly successful global exporter.

"After the cadetship, I took up a position with Trade and investment Queensland in overseas market development and have recently moved into a role with a global management consultancy.

"I believe the skills and knowledge acquired during my cadetship will continue to provide a positive base for my career."
